Flooding reaches Hyderabad |
2010-08-22 |
As floodwaters reached the outskirts of Hyderabad and Thatta on Saturday, more villages and towns were inundated. As the water level in Indus River near Kotri Barrage increased to 760,511 cusecs, floodwater entered Hyderabad's suburbs of Hussainabad and Lab-e-Mehran Park. The army breached illegal dykes to save Hyderabad city from floods. The Hyderabad district coordination officer (DCO) called an emergency meeting to take precautionary measures to save the city from floodwater. |
